The much-awaited action-drama ‘Toxic: A Fairy Tale for Grown-Ups’ continues to create massive buzz across India. Sources close to the production have confirmed that Nayanthara will play a powerful and emotionally pivotal role as Yash’s sister, shaping the film’s dramatic and action-heavy narrative. Her character, Ganga, is said to drive key story arcs alongside Yash’s protagonist Raya.


Massive Pan-India Star Cast

The film features one of the strongest multi-industry ensembles in recent years:

Yash as Raya

The Kannada superstar leads the film in a dark, stylish gangster avatar.

Nayanthara as Ganga

Plays Yash’s sister—described as a high-impact, emotionally charged role essential to the film’s action graph.

Kiara Advani as Nadia

The lead actress, with a character reportedly inspired by Cirque du Soleil performers.

Huma Qureshi as Elizabeth

A powerful antagonist with a dominating on-screen presence.

Tara Sutaria as Rebecca

Appears in a glamorous and crucial role.

Rukmini Vasanth as Mellisa

Adds dramatic depth to the ensemble.

Additional Cast

Tovino Thomas, Akshay Oberoi, and Sudev Nair will also appear in important roles.


🎬 Teaser Shatters Records

The official first teaser—titled “Introducing Raya”—was released on January 8, 2026, at 10:10 AM, marking Yash’s 40th birthday celebration.

Within just 24 hours, the teaser:

  • Crossed 220 million+ views across platforms

  • Set new social media engagement records

  • Established Yash’s return as one of the biggest pan-India cinematic moments

The teaser showcases Yash in a dark, violent, sleek gangster world, setting expectations for a visually rich and emotionally intense narrative.


🎥 Theatrical Release Date

‘Toxic: A Fairy Tale for Grown-Ups’ is set for a global theatrical release on March 19, 2026, in:

  • Kannada

  • Hindi

  • Tamil

  • Telugu

  • Malayalam

The film’s multilingual rollout signals major pan-India ambitions and international audience appeal.
